Neurofibromata and café-au-lait macules in a patient with neurofibromatosis 1 (NF1)
Skin-colored and pink-tan, soft papules and nodules on the back are neurofibromata. These lesions first appeared during late childhood. The large, soft, ill-defined, subcutaneous nodule on the right lower back is a plexiform neuroma. The café-au-lait macules appeared earlier in childhood. A large one is visible on the middle lower back.
